>> PRESENTATION(S) AND/OR DISCUSSION(S)
>>
>>    General Discussion -
>>
>>      Meetings are open to new people who just want to come and drink
>> some
>>      coffee with fellow local Linux geeks. The meetings are honestly
>> more
>>      of a sitting around and talking shop and not typically organized or
>>      lead by anyone. If new people show up, we will do introductions.
>>
>>      Typically meetings break up into a few discussions and people talk
>>      about different topics related to Linux. If you're interested in
>>      presenting something to the group, we're more than willing to have
>>      your speak about your question/topic/etc.
>>
>>    Geek Technical Support -
>>
>>      As usual, you are encouraged to bring your laptop/pc and if you
>>      have a problem or would like someone to assist you with trouble-
>>      shooting, we're always open to lending a helping hand.
>>
>>    Anything goes -
>>
>>      Bring your questions and curiosity...
>>      we're all open to helping and answering the best we can.
